GroupDocs.Assembly for Java
GroupDocs.Assembly for Java是一个文档生成和报表自动化API,用于迅速从模板创建自定义文档。APIs从已定义的数据源(如数据库、Odata、JSON、XML或自定义java对象)获取数据,并使用已定义的文档模板生成文件或报表。
文档生成API支持各种模板元素,如重复块、条件块、文本块和HTML块、图表和图像。这些元素被添加到文档模板中,以根据需求创建丰富的文档。每个模板元素都有自己的格式属性,比如文本、图表、数值格式等等。
Java Assembly API如何自动化文档生成过程概述
数据操作
公式
连续的数据操作
类型成员调用
内置的数据关系
外部文件导入
数据处理自定义
模板元素
格式化的文本块
HTML块
重复块
条件块
图片
图表
条形码
超链接
数据格式
数据库
XML
OData
JSON
自定义Java对象
电子表格作为数据表
词处理表作为数据表
模板元素格式
数字/日期时间值
文本格式
有条件的文本格式
图像格式
图表格式
高级文档生成API功能
多种文件格式的支持
从多个数据源生成文档
数据操作功能
支持多个模板元素
支持多种模板元素格式化
模板的语法格式
基于LINQ的模板语法